CLEMENTINE & WINSTON CHURCHILL
A one-page typed letter, signed, from Clementine Churchill at Chartwell, Westerham, Kent, 14th February 1933, giving a secretarial reference for Miss Edwards: "She is very methodical and neat and is entirely trustworthy in every respect." The post-script added in Churchill's hand reads: "I consider Miss Edwards to be a capable accountant, and I should be very glad to recommend her to anybody requiring her services."
With a second letter from Clementine Churchill, dated Chartwell, September 19th, also to Miss Edwards declaring: "I miss you horribly ... I felt sustained and soothed while you were with me." (2)
